mysql与c++相连 c与mysql教程

导读:
C语言是一种高级编程语言,被广泛应用于系统编程、嵌入式开发等领域 。而MySQL则是一种流行的关系型数据库管理系统,可以用来存储和管理数据 。本教程将介绍如何在C语言中使用MySQL进行数据库操作 。
1. 安装MySQL
【mysql与c++相连 c与mysql教程】首先需要安装MySQL,下载并安装MySQL Community Server即可 。安装完成后,需要在命令行中输入以下命令启动MySQL服务:sudo /usr/local/mysql/support-files/mysql.server start
2. 连接MySQL
使用C语言连接MySQL需要使用MySQL C API库 。在代码中需要包含mysql.h头文件,并使用mysql_init()函数初始化一个MYSQL结构体 , 然后使用mysql_real_connect()函数连接到MySQL服务器 。
3. 执行SQL语句
连接成功后 , 就可以执行SQL语句了 。使用mysql_query()函数可以执行任意SQL语句,例如SELECT、INSERT、UPDATE等 。
4. 处理查询结果
如果执行的SQL语句是SELECT语句,则需要使用mysql_store_result()函数获取查询结果 。然后使用mysql_num_rows()函数获取查询结果的行数,mysql_fetch_row()函数逐行获取查询结果的每一行数据 。
5. 关闭连接
在使用完MySQL后,需要使用mysql_close()函数关闭与MySQL的连接 。
总结:
本教程介绍了如何在C语言中使用MySQL进行数据库操作,包括安装MySQL、连接MySQL、执行SQL语句、处理查询结果和关闭连接 。掌握这些知识可以帮助开发者更好地利用MySQL进行数据管理和操作 。

    推荐阅读